package org.apache.flink.ml.feature.lsh;

import org.apache.flink.ml.param.IntParam;
import org.apache.flink.ml.param.Param;
import org.apache.flink.ml.param.ParamValidators;

/**
 * Params for {@link LSH}.
 *
 * @param  The class type of this instance.
 */
public interface LSHParams extends LSHModelParams {

    /**
     * Param for the number of hash tables used in LSH OR-amplification.
     *
     * 

OR-amplification can be used to reduce the false negative rate. Higher values of this * param lead to a reduced false negative rate, at the expense of added computational * complexity. */ Param NUM_HASH_TABLES = new IntParam("numHashTables", "Number of hash tables.", 1, ParamValidators.gtEq(1)); /** * Param for the number of hash functions per hash table used in LSH AND-amplification. * *

AND-amplification can be used to reduce the false positive rate. Higher values of this * param lead to a reduced false positive rate, at the expense of added computational * complexity. */ Param NUM_HASH_FUNCTIONS_PER_TABLE = new IntParam( "numHashFunctionsPerTable", "Number of hash functions per table.", 1, ParamValidators.gtEq(1)); default int getNumHashTables() { return get(NUM_HASH_TABLES); } default T setNumHashTables(Integer value) { return set(NUM_HASH_TABLES, value); } default int getNumHashFunctionsPerTable() { return get(NUM_HASH_FUNCTIONS_PER_TABLE); } default T setNumHashFunctionsPerTable(Integer value) { return set(NUM_HASH_FUNCTIONS_PER_TABLE, value); } }
